    Description

    The Consultant shall provide professional engineering, planning, environmental, public outreach, and grant support services necessary to evaluate railroad crossing safety improvements at four (4) at-grade railroad crossings within the AlamedaCorridor-East (ACE) Phase III Project.The Project includes alternatives analysis, conceptual engineering, environmental documentation, stakeholder coordination, conceptual cost estimating, benefit-cost analysis, and preparation of grant-ready technical documentation necessary to advance one (1) preferred crossing improvement alternative toward future implementation.The Consultant shall perform all services in accordance with the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) Railroad Crossing Elimination (RCE) Program requirements and all applicable federal, state, and local laws, regulations, and guidelines.Conceptual engineering developed under this Contract may advance the preferred alternative to approximately thirty-five percent (35%) design solely to support alternatives analysis, environmental review, utility coordination, right-of-way assessment, conceptual cost estimating, and future funding applications. Such work shall not constitute final design or final Plans, Specifications and Estimates (PS&E).
